Floor soundproofing materials are the products built into a floor-ceiling assembly to reduce sound passing between levels: damping compound between subfloor layers, acoustical sealant at the perimeter and around penetrations, and resilient layers under the finished surface.

Two kinds of noise cross a floor, and they respond to different materials. Airborne noise, meaning conversation, television, and music from the level below, is reduced by adding mass and damping to the assembly. Impact noise, meaning footsteps, dropped objects, and chairs scraping, is reduced by resilient isolation between the finished floor and the structure.

Why Floors Need Soundproofing Materials

A floor-ceiling assembly connects two rooms through solid structure. Joists, subfloor, and ceiling board form a rigid path, and vibration entering at one end travels the whole way with very little loss. A bare assembly of joists, plywood, and drywall stops less sound than most people expect, which is why the level below hears a television at moderate volume.

Mass and damping address the airborne half of the problem. Adding a second layer of subfloor increases mass, and a damping compound sandwiched between the two layers converts vibration into small amounts of heat as the layers try to flex against each other. The compound prevents the assembly from ringing like a single stiff panel.

Air gaps undo the rest. Sound follows any opening it can find, and a floor assembly has plenty: the gap between the subfloor and the wall plate, plumbing and electrical penetrations, HVAC boots, and the joint where new flooring meets an existing partition. Sealing those openings costs a fraction of the mass layer and often changes the result more.

Damping Compound for Subfloor Assemblies

Green Glue Noiseproofing Compound is a viscoelastic damping compound applied between two layers of subfloor, drywall, or plywood. The material stays tacky permanently and never cures rigid the way construction adhesive does, which is what allows it to keep absorbing vibration for the life of the assembly.

Application follows a fixed rate: two tubes, or two gun dispenses, per 4x8 sheet, applied in a random pattern across the back of the second layer with a 3-inch border left clear at the edges. The second layer is then screwed down through the first, and the compound is sandwiched between them.

Three formats are available. The case of 12 tubes covers roughly 192 square feet at the recommended rate. The 5-gallon pail is equivalent to 23 tubes, or about 368 square feet, and is well-suited to larger areas where a bulk dispensing gun makes sense. Acoustical Sealant for Perimeter and Penetrations

Green Glue Acoustical Sealant is an acoustic-grade caulk for the joints and cracks in soundproof floor, wall, and ceiling systems. Sound flanking through small openings is one of the most common reasons a finished assembly underperforms its design, and sealant closes those paths.

Each 28-ounce tube covers roughly 40 to 50 linear feet at a 3/8-inch bead and fits a quart-sized caulking gun. Application takes no training, since it goes on like standard caulk. The material dries fully in 48 hours, cleans up with soap and water while wet, and takes paint once dry. Tube and case options are listed under Acoustical Sealants.

On a floor, the sealant belongs at the subfloor perimeter where it meets wall framing, around every pipe and conduit passing through the deck, at HVAC boot openings, and along seams between subfloor sheets in a two-layer build.

Resilient underlayment and isolation pads are the materials that address impact noise, and neither is currently in our catalog. Rubber or cork underlayment is installed between the subfloor and the finished surface; isolation pads and mats sit on top of the finished floor under gym equipment, treadmills, or golf simulators.

If footsteps from above are the complaint, those products are what the job needs, and the damping and sealing materials on this page will not substitute for them. Building a Soundproof Floor Assembly

Materials perform according to where they sit in the assembly and the order in which they go down. The sequence below applies to new construction and to renovations where the subfloor is exposed.

Layer Order From Joists Up

A damped two-layer subfloor follows a consistent build: joists; insulation in the cavity if the cavity is open; the first subfloor layer fastened to the joists; damping compound applied to the back of the second layer; the second subfloor layer screwed down through the first; then underlayment and finished flooring.

Each layer does one job. The first layer provides structure; the compound absorbs flex between layers; the second layer adds mass; and the underlayment handles impact.

Sealing the Perimeter First

Run a bead of acoustical sealant where the subfloor meets wall framing before the finished floor goes down, and again around every penetration through the deck. Sealing at this stage takes minutes; reaching the same joints after the flooring is installed usually requires removing the flooring.

Leave a small expansion gap at the perimeter and fill it with sealant rather than closing it with rigid material. A rigid connection at the edge gives vibration a direct route into the wall, which defeats the work done in the middle of the floor.

Where Damping Compound Goes

The compound belongs between two rigid layers and nowhere else. Applied to a single layer with nothing above it, it does nothing at all, since damping depends on two surfaces shearing against each other.

Apply the compound to the back of the second layer in a random pattern, then fasten that layer down through the first while the compound is still fresh. No specific pattern is required, and screw spacing follows normal subfloor practice.

Floor Side or Ceiling Side

Most floor-ceiling assemblies can be treated from either direction, and the right side depends on the type of noise and on which surface you are willing to open up.

When to Work From the Floor Side

Floor-side treatment makes sense during new construction, during a renovation that already involves replacing flooring, and whenever the subfloor is exposed for other reasons. It also handles impact noise, which can only be addressed by putting resilience between footsteps and the structure.

When to Work From the Ceiling Side

Treating Both Sides

Projects with the highest requirements, such as studios and home theaters below occupied rooms, treat both surfaces: a damped, sealed subfloor above and a decoupled, damped ceiling below. Doing both is worth the cost only when the target is genuine isolation rather than noticeable improvement.

Damping Works Where Mass Alone Falls Short

Doubling the subfloor thickness adds mass, and mass alone makes the two layers act as one stiff panel that transmits vibration efficiently. A damping layer between them breaks that behavior, which is why a damped two-layer floor outperforms an undamped one of the same total thickness.

/01What is the difference between airborne and impact noise on a floor?

Airborne noise travels through the air before hitting the assembly: voices, television, music. Impact noise starts as a physical strike on the floor: footsteps, dropped objects, furniture. Mass and damping reduce the first; resilient isolation reduces the second.

/01Can I soundproof a floor without removing the existing flooring?

Not effectively from above. A damping compound must sit between two structural layers, which means the subfloor must be accessible. When the floor has to stay, treat the ceiling below with isolation clips, SONOpan, and damping compound between drywall layers.

/01Should I treat the floor or the ceiling?

For airborne noise from below, the ceiling side is usually more effective and far less disruptive. For impact noise from above, the floor side is the only place resilience can be introduced. Projects with strict requirements treat both.

/01Do I need acoustical sealant if I am already using damping compound?

Yes. The compound handles vibration through the assembly, and the sealant closes the air gaps around it. An unsealed perimeter gap allows sound to bypass the treated area entirely, erasing much of the benefit.
